Dorset celebrates its stars

Dorset tourism businesses were celebrating in numbers this week as winners and sponsors of the 12th Dorset Tourism Awards were presented at Marsham Court Hotel in Bournemouth.

The event was the conclusion of five months of independent judging as hospitality businesses of all kinds were recognised for their excellence in customer service, sustainability, digital communications and accessibility.

Guests were inspired by a presentation from Portland based Olympic stars Etienne Stott and Laura Baldwin, who shared their tips on the importance of winning and environmental protection.

61 winner trophies were presented including a Winner of Winners award to Careys Secret Garden and a special Outstanding Contribution award to Professor Peter Jones for his work in skills development and accessibility.

Amanda Park of sponsors Visit Dorset said: “Visit Dorset are proud sponsors of the Dorset Tourism Awards and as always, we were delighted to have the opportunity last night to celebrate the sheer variety and quality of businesses across the whole of Dorset’s fantastic tourism industry, which contributes so much to our Dorset economy. Congratulations to all the finalists!”

Awards organiser Robin Barker of Services for Tourism added: “It is such a great reward for the hard working teams in tourism and hospitality to receive this recognition, and it is so deserved. Congratulations to all the winners.”

Many of the Gold winners in the Dorset Awards will also be nominated to represent Dorset in the national VisitEngland awards later in the year.
